Output eebba0102d9982010613b98d720950234a7acf54d1086e0a461876ab6a6c0921:0

value
38544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28bd592c32bedc95154876b67ff01ab766c3da2f OP_EQUAL
address
35QRnNPgUasBeyLSkC1yR5jcCjkxPyvowU
transaction
eebba0102d9982010613b98d720950234a7acf54d1086e0a461876ab6a6c0921
spent
true